Investment portfolio

  • Avisi Technologies

    Participated · Series A · Feb 2026

    Avisi Technologies, Inc. is a clinical-stage company focused on creating novel ophthalmic solutions, most notably VisiPlate®, an investigational aqueous shunt engineered from an ultrathin, patented metamaterial designed to maintain intra-ocular pressure through multiple microchannels that resist blockage and scarring. The device targets the unmet need for long-term, low-maintenance glaucoma care and is currently being evaluated in the FDA IDE-approved SAPPHIRE pivotal trial that is enrolling patients across the United States. Avisi’s broader pipeline includes V-001, a sustained intraocular drug-delivery platform, and VisiPlate-S, a drainage device intended for use during cataract surgery. Proceeds from its latest financing will fund the SAPPHIRE trial and advance additional pipeline programs addressing the full spectrum of glaucomatous disease. The company has garnered recognition and non-dilutive support from the National Science Foundation, the Glaucoma Research Foundation, Johnson & Johnson JLABS, and other industry accelerators. Current investors include both venture funds and angel networks, underscoring diversified backing for its development roadmap. No revenue or user figures have been disclosed to date.

  • Lumino

    Participated · Seed · Mar 2024

    Lumino is building an integrated hardware and software compute protocol for AI workloads that uses economic incentives to aggregate compute resources. The protocol leverages blockchain to ensure models are being trained correctly and provides a developer SDK so customers can start training models in minutes. The company was founded in July 2023 by Eshan Chordia and Yogesh Darji and is based in San Francisco, CA. Lumino raised $2.8M in pre-seed funding and intends to use the funds to expand operations and development efforts. Its core offering combines marketplace incentives, trusted training verification via blockchain, and an SDK to lower onboarding friction for developers. The article does not report revenue or user metrics.

  • Gridwise

    Participated · Seed · Feb 2020

    Gridwise offers a mobile app for rideshare and gig drivers that aggregates real-time airport activity, local events, weather, and traffic to help drivers boost earnings. The app has evolved to let users track earnings across platforms (Uber, Lyft) and to track mileage and expenses. According to Gridwise, over 300k rideshare and delivery drivers use its free app. The company has expanded into financial products via a partnership with Kover (now Seel) to launch Gridwise Protection, an income protection and sick leave product for drivers, though that product is not accepting new customers at this time. Earlier this year Gridwise announced it will offer users benefits from Avibra’s Dollar Benefits Store. Founded in 2016, the company continues to focus on tools and benefits tailored to gig‑economy drivers. Gridwise collects and aggregates data from traffic services, social media, weather, events, local news and crowdsourced driver inputs via its mobile app to provide real-time alerts and aggregate analytics. The company says drivers using its app have produced 300 million tracked ride-hailing miles and that drivers can earn as much as 39% more per hour. Gridwise works across platforms including Uber, Lyft and Via, and already tracks food delivery starting with Uber Eats. The Pittsburgh-based startup, founded in 2016, plans to unlock ride-share and delivery insights for municipalities, mobile service platforms, insurance providers and other stakeholders. Product plans include expanding tracking to grocery and parcel deliveries to broaden its view of how people and goods move in cities. The company positions its cross-platform data as a differentiator versus single-provider programs and aims to monetize aggregate analytics for corporate and municipal customers. Gridwise aggregates third-party APIs (traffic, social media, weather, events, local news) and crowdsourced driver data to deliver real-time alerts on where and when to drive. The app notifies drivers about airport congestion, event-driven demand, and weather, and tracks mileage, time, earnings, and trips. It offers a free basic tier and a paid Gridwise Plus plan ($10/month or $96/year) with additional features like 24-hour airport graphs and real-time flight status. Gridwise says it can help drivers earn as much as 39% more per hour and reports some 40,000 drivers using the app across 18 U.S. cities, including recent launches in San Francisco and San Jose. Founded in 2016 and a Techstars alum, the company is headquartered in Pittsburgh and had seven employees at the time of the article. Management plans to invest in R&D for autonomous ride-hailing use cases and pursue international expansion after growing its U.S. driver network.

  • Kaarta

    Participated · Series A · Mar 2019

    Kaarta develops real-time mobile 3D reality capture technology that maps complex indoor and outdoor environments without external signal infrastructure such as GPS or Wi‑Fi. Its patent-pending, robotics-rooted platform transforms the real world into multidimensional 3D digital models up to 10x faster and at lower cost than traditional mapping methods. Kaarta’s products are used across architecture, engineering, construction, operations, industrial planning, civil and transportation infrastructure, security, mining, archaeology, and autonomous technologies. Customers include Badger Technologies, which uses Kaarta to map 60,000 sq ft stores in under an hour and has captured over 400 retail locations for a first customer. In three full years of operation Kaarta has built a global distribution network and an expanding addressable market. The company secured $6.5M in Series A financing to fuel sales and marketing, expand talent acquisition, and further invest in research and development.
